well, i've got a solution for you.
i'm pretty sure there are a couple free auto-explore scripts (i know alexio has one)
to use it, you need to have TWX (i am assuming you have it)
well, TWX records data such as anomolies you've seen (assuming recording is on, which it should be)
hit $ in your telnet client, then hit D.
this will bring you to the data menu.
hit ?
this will give you a list of all the data type goodness TWX has recorded.
for anomolies, hit A. (you can check densities, enemy figs, traders, etc... as well)

And my script only pulls its data from the TWX database. It gets the data from everything TWX has seen. So like Slim said, if you were not using TWX the last time you saw sector X, and there was an anomoly in it, neither TWX or my script will know about that sector. The only thing my script does over just going into TWX's interrogation menu is it writes all those sectors to a txt file. It also does many other listings such as sectors with fighters, mines, traders, planets, etc, etc, etc.
